Vista Equity to take insurtech Duck Creek private
Investment firm Vista Equity Partners is buying insurtech Duck Creek Technologies for US$2.6 billion, according to PYMNTS.
The companies announced the all-cash deal, which takes Duck Creek private, in a news release Monday.
Based in Boston, Duck Creek provides solutions for the property and casualty (P&C) and general insurance industry.
The acquisition is expected to close in the second quarter of 2023.
Vista Equity is headquartered in Austin, and has US$95 billion in assets under management.
Last October saw the company purchase cybersecurity firm KnowBe4 for US$4.6 billion.
